Backing Up Your Data

  • Create a full system backup: A full system image backup protects everything on your hard drive in case something goes wrong during the transfer. Software like Macrium Reflect or EaseUS Todo Backup is highly recommended. This ensures you have a failsafe should anything unexpected occur. Restoring from a backup is far simpler than recovering files individually.
  • Back up important files separately: Even with a full system image, backing up critical personal files like documents, photos, and videos to external storage is crucial. This adds an extra layer of security, giving you a second copy of your most valuable data. Think of it as insurance against unforeseen issues.

Partitioning Your SSD

  • Consider a single partition: Many users find it simpler to have one large partition on their SSD, allocating all available space to the C: drive. This simplifies file management, but it limits flexibility if you later decide you want separate partitions.
  • Multiple partitions for organization: Alternatively, you could create separate partitions for the operating system, applications, and user data. This can improve performance and security by isolating different types of data. For instance, the OS on a separate partition can help with a cleaner system restore.

Using Robocopy (for advanced users)

Cloning Your Hard Drive

Cloning your hard drive is a popular method to move everything from your old hard drive, including your operating system and all settings, to your SSD. This approach minimizes disruption and guarantees a seamless transition. This often is the fastest approach, especially for large volumes of data.

Using Third-Party Cloning Software

  • EaseUS Todo Backup: A user-friendly cloning tool capable of handling large hard drives and creating bootable backups.
  • Macrium Reflect: A robust and feature-rich cloning solution known for its reliability and comprehensive features.
  • AOMEI Backupper: Provides a range of backup and cloning functionalities, including sector-by-sector cloning.

Defragmentation (Not Necessary)

Unlike traditional hard drives, SSDs do not require defragmentation. The process can actually harm an SSD’s lifespan, as it generates unnecessary write cycles. This is a common misconception to avoid.

TRIM Command

  • Enabling TRIM: The TRIM command allows the operating system to inform the SSD which data blocks are no longer in use, allowing the SSD to erase them efficiently and improving performance over time. It is generally enabled by default in modern Windows systems.

FAQ

What if I run out of space on my SSD?

If you run out of space, you can delete unnecessary files, use cloud storage to move files off your SSD, or consider buying a larger SSD.

Can I transfer only certain files and folders?

Yes, you can selectively transfer files and folders using File Explorer or other file management tools. You do not have to move everything at once.

What is the best way to move my operating system?

The most efficient way to move your operating system is by cloning your hard drive to the SSD using a third-party cloning tool.

Can I upgrade without losing my data?

You can minimize data loss by backing up your important files before the transfer. Cloning your hard drive is also a reliable method to preserve your data.

How long does the data transfer take?

The transfer time depends on the amount of data and the speed of your hard drive and SSD. It can range from a few minutes to several hours.

What are the potential risks of moving data?

The main risks are data loss due to errors or interruptions during the transfer. Proper backups mitigate these risks effectively.

What happens if the transfer is interrupted?

If the transfer is interrupted, you may lose some data. That is why a backup is a necessary precaution.
